CVE-2018-1605

UnknownEPSS 0.66%

Last modified

CVE-2018-1605 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. IBM Rational Quality Manager (RQM) 5.0 through 5.02 and 6.0 through 6.0.6 are vulnerable to cross-site scripting. This vulnerability allows users to embed arbitrary JavaScript code in the Web UI thus altering the intended functionality potentially leading to credentials disclosure within a trusted session. EPSS estimates a 0.66%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
